Trailer and clips preview gothic horror drama The Little Stranger

It's not getting a whole lot of attention, but there is a gothic horror film coming to theatres this weekend – one directed by Lenny Abrahamson, Oscar-nominated director of ROOM, and based on a novel by Sarah Waters that Stephen King called a "terrifying, engrossing ghost story". 

The film is called THE LITTLE STRANGER. Lucinda Coxon wrote the screenplay adaptation to bring the following story to the screen: 

During the long, hot summer of 1948, Dr. Faraday travels to Hundreds Hall, home to the Ayres family for more than two centuries. The Hall is now in decline, and its inhabitants — mother, son, and daughter — remain haunted by something more ominous than a dying way of life. When Faraday takes on a new patient there, he has no idea how closely the family's story is about to become entwined with his own.

Domhnall Gleeson stars as Faraday, with Charlotte Rampling, Will Poulter, and Ruth Wilson as the Ayres family.
